00:01Plans for a new Sir Bobby Robson Institute in Newcastle have been approved by city councillors.
00:07The £30 million centre will be built at the Freeman Hospital.
00:10It will bring together existing cancer research teams and expand clinical trials.
00:16£20 million has already been raised, with £10 million still needed.
00:21Construction is due to start early next year to open in 2028.
00:25The facility is expected to increase cancer trials in Newcastle by 50%.
00:30Professor Ruth Plummer, consultant medical oncologist at Newcastle Hospitals,
00:36says more trials will lead to better outcomes for patients.
00:40Officials say it will strengthen research and care services.
